- The distance between Turiacu, Brazil and Hutts Gate, Saint Helena is approximately 4,630 km or 2,877 mi.
- To reach Turiacu in this distance one would set out from Hutts Gate bearing 285.9°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Turiacu bearing 292.3° or WNW .
- Turiacu has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as Hutts Gate has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b).
- The annual mean temperature is 9.2 °C (16.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.6 °C (6.5°F) less in Turiacu.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1381.2 mm (54.4 in) more which is equivalent to 1381.2 l/m² (33.9 US gal/ft²) or 13,812,000 l/ha (1,476,594 US gal/ac) more. About 2 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 4° higher in Turiacu than in Hutts Gate.
- Relative humidity levels are 1.9%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 9.4°C (16.9°F) higher.
